HIS HONOUR: The applicant, Botany Municipal Council, made on 24 March 1988 a Class IV application, which it amended on 6 May 1988, for injunction to restrain the respondents from using or causing or permitting the use of certain premises as:-
(a) a brothel, or
(b) a health studio, or
(c) a place for the entertainment of male or female persons, or
(d) an escort agency.
The subject premises are known as 1397A Botany Road, Botany, and consist of the first floor of a building which has stairway access from Botany Road at the front entrance and a laneway at the rear entrance.
The first respondents are named as Fotios Tsolakis and Theoni Tsolakis. They are alleged to be the owners of the subject premises, which they admitted; but they denied using or allowing the premises to be used for any of the above purposes. On the second day of the case their counsel withdrew after informing the Court that his clients submitted to such order as the Court saw fit to make except as to costs.
